No. 6 Texas A&M hits over .500 in regular-season finale sweep Georgia

Needing just 76 minutes to sweep the Georgia Bulldogs, No. 6 Texas A&M is now riding a 10-match winning streak as the Aggies finished the regular season with a 22-3 record and 14-1 in conference. As the No. 2 seed in the SEC Tournament, A&M will play in Sunday's quarterfinals.

Match #25: No. 6 Texas A&M 3, Georgia 0
S1: A&M, 25-13; S2: A&M, 25-17; S3: A&M, 25-13
Records: Texas A&M (22-3, 14-1), Georgia (16-9, 8-7)
Box Score


Ending the regular season on a high note.

No. 6 Texas A&M volleyball swept Georgia on Sunday in its final regular-season match of the season in front of 5,751 at Reed Arena. A&M’s 22-3 record is its best start since 1984, marking a historic season for the Aggies.

The reigning SEC Setter of the Week, Maddie Waak, had 37 assists as she surpassed 1,000 assists for the season. She is the first Aggie to achieve this feat in back-to-back seasons since Camille Conner in 2018 and 2019.

“She should be an All-American,” A&M head coach Jamie Morrison said of Waak. “I think she’s winning the SEC awards, but I’m hoping, at the end of the year, she gets the national recognition. Our offense wouldn’t be what it is without her distributing.”

National Player of the Year semifinalist Logan Lednicky led the offense with 13 kills, as she officially ends the SEC slate with double-digit kills in every conference match this season.

Ifenna Cos-Okpalla and Kyndal Stowers each had 10 kills, while Emily Hellmuth had eight.

Multiple ties marked the beginning of the opening set until an ace from Stowers put the Aggies in the lead, 13-9, causing the Bulldogs to take a timeout. The Maroon & White then went on a 4-0 run, increasing its lead to seven.

Of the Aggies’ 22 wins, 14 ended in sweeps, including nine in conference play. 

A&M continued to dominate, taking the set 25-13.

The second stanza began with four early ties, but the Aggies quickly took control, as they led 15-10 going into the media timeout.

A service error from Georgia put the Maroon & White within five points of a set win, and on her ninth kill of the day, Lednicky closed out the set, 25-17.

The first five points of the final frame belonged to A&M, which caused Georgia to call a timeout as they sought to end the Aggies' torment.

The Bulldogs were unsuccessful as the Ags continued to control the match, and down 13-3, they called their final timeout.

Georgia came back with slightly more fire, but it was too little too late, and a kill from Megan Fitch ended the match, 25-13.

A packed Reed Arena for an early Sunday match marked the second-highest attendance this season and fourth-most in program history. This level of fan support is precisely what Morrison came here for.

“I’m just blown away and thankful, there’s gratitude and pride also,” Morrison said. “I came here for building this because I love the sport of volleyball, and I wanted a passionate fan base to be able to experience that and fall in love with it the way that I love it.

“I don’t think I can express enough gratitude for what I have for the 12th Man, for the way they’ve shown up in terms of numbers, the way that people show up with passion, the way that people want to support. They want to help us win, and it’s helping.”

The Aggies close out their regular season second in the SEC with a 22-3 overall record and 14-1 in conference play. The SEC tournament will begin on Friday, Nov. 21, in Savannah, Georgia, but A&M will have a double bye and won’t play again until next Sunday.

“It’s just a special group,” said Lednicky. “A lot of us have been here and seen the progress, and a lot of people have joined along on the way. It’s cool to see just how far we’ve come and end the season on a high note.”
